Engineering Internship

True Anomaly is seeking engineering interns to contribute to innovative technology for space security and sustainability through hands-on experience in spacecraft system design and development.

Skills

  • Engineering knowledge
  • Mechanical design skills
  • Collaboration and teamwork
  • Problem-solving attitude
  • Presentation skills

Responsibilities

  • Create detailed mechanical designs for Ground Support Equipment.
  • Design structural and mechanical interfaces between spacecraft buses and payloads.
  • Collaborate on wiring harness layout for spacecraft subsystems.
  • Develop test plans for environmental qualification tests.
  • Assist in GNC algorithm design and testing.

Education

  • Currently enrolled in an engineering discipline at a four-year accredited university.
